# Multiple Listing Service (MLS)

*Real Estate — Finicade finance glossary*

The MLS is the shared database agents use to list properties and share commissions, and it's the source feeding public portals. Access has historically been the profession's central advantage, and the US legal settlements over commission rules in 2024 changed how that access is paid for. Listings outside it — pocket listings — reduce exposure and, usually, the seller's price.
